Product Description:

The MHD093A-024-PG1-AA is a servo motor manufactured by Bosch Rexroth Indramat for the MHD Synchronous Motors series. It is intended for closed-loop positioning and speed control in machine tools, packaging equipment, and material-handling axes that require repeatable motion. In operation, the motor receives regulated current from a matching drive controller and converts it into rotary torque at the shaft. This arrangement supports direct coupling to the driven axis while keeping the installation compact. It is suitable for axes that need accurate starts, stops, and repeatable speed changes.

The motor produces a continuous standstill torque of 12.0 Nm, which provides steady holding force while the axis is energized but not rotating. A centering diameter of 130 mm and a flange pattern of 140 / 150 mm provide the mechanical interface for rigid mounting. Once installed, the housing reaches IP65 protection, which helps keep dust and low-pressure water jets away from internal components. Cooling is handled by natural convection, so no external blower is required during operation in ambient temperatures from 0 to 40 °C. The motor uses Insulation Class F windings with winding code 024, and the 093 frame with A length gives a compact form factor. A plain shaft with a shaft seal and the power connector on side A complete the layout.

An integrated holding brake rated at 22.0 Nm secures vertical or suspended loads when power is removed. The digital feedback system uses optical measurement and absolute position detection over more than 4096 revolutions, supporting closed-loop control with system accuracy of ± 0.5 arcminutes. This feedback arrangement allows the drive to monitor shaft position continuously during indexing and speed-regulated motion. For storage, the motor can remain in temperatures from -20 to +80 °C. Installation altitude should not exceed 1000 m above mean sea level.
